Output e59321c88d66bc9adb99b8ae23833a56720d4ee455b7382cafc9e780845979ad:9

value
42352
script pubkey
OP_0 OP_PUSHBYTES_20 643ad48b312866a9ca5771ca0ab0012fd2444ac7
address
ltc1qvsadfze39pn2njjhw89q4vqp9lfygjk8h5lw4s
transaction
e59321c88d66bc9adb99b8ae23833a56720d4ee455b7382cafc9e780845979ad
spent
false